About Igatpuri

Igatpuri is a town and a municipal council in Nashik district in the Indian state of Maharashtra. It is located on the Mumbai-Agra National Highway (NH3) and is about from Mumbai. Igatpuri is a taluka place in Nashik district. Igatpuri is located at an altitude of and has a population of Igatpuri is well known as a religious place with many temples and ghats. It is also a popular tourist destination because of its location in the Sahyadri Hills and its proximity to Mumbai. The temples in Igatpuri include the Vihaguri Temple, the Kalaram Temple, the Ganesha Temple, the Narayan Temple, and the Dattatray Temple. The ghats in Igatpuri include the Gandhi Ghat, the Hanuman Ghat, the Ram Ghat, and the Saptashringi Ghat. FAQ's on Igatpuri

1. What is famous about Igatpuri?

Igatpuri is famous for its temples and for its scenic beauty.

4. What is the best time to visit Igatpuri?

Igatpuri is a place which can be visited throughout the year. However, the best time to visit Igatpuri is during the months of October to February.

6. What is the best way to reach Igatpuri?

The best way to reach Igatpuri is to take a train from Mumbai to Igatpuri.
